WA Public Transport Authority
Provision of Printing and Mail Distribution Services
Details
Description
The Public Transport Authority of Western Australia (PTA) is seeking the services of a suitably qualified and experienced provider to undertake the bulk printing and distribution functions, on behalf of the PTA Office of Major Transport Infrastructure Delivery (OMTID) Branch, and Customer Strategy and Communications (CSAC) Branch. The process of unaddressed letterbox drop represents a key service in the delivery of the notices issued by OMTID and CSAC to that affect local residents and businesses. The function includes the printing, paper handling, enveloping, and mailing of brochures, notices, correspondences, and posters as required. The purpose of these letter drops includes (but is not limited to): notification of out-of-hours works (night works), major rail disruptions, or impactful construction activities, providing general information about one-off work packages or larger, ongoing infrastructure projects (e.g. project overview or updates, brochures, fact sheets, etc.), invitation to community engagement activities (information sessions, reference group participation), offer of property condition surveys etc.
